Creating a will is not just about expressing your desires but additionally concerning doing so in a way that's legally valid. To start, you must go to least 18 years old and possess audio psychological capacity, implying you're totally knowledgeable about your home and beneficiaries, and comprehend exactly how your possessions are being distributed. A will certainly needs you to identify the assets and property that are to be bequeathed in addition to the identifications of the intended recipients (referred to as called recipients). To provide lasting take care of a loved one with special requirements, it's best to establish a special requirements trust. The trust fund can direct the treatment and supply ongoing earnings, without influencing the advantages they can likewise receive through government programs. You should make setups for any small children or grownups with special needs under your care. This doesn't constantly suggest you assign an individual to care for your kids-- it can suggest you mark an individual to pick that deals with your children if you pass away. You can leave your estate to any person or institution you want, including family members, buddies, nonprofits, or colleges. Having a clear guardianship strategy ensures your long for them are executed and can assist prevent unneeded court participation or further disturbance to your dependents' lives.
